What are aerosols and why do they matter?

Aerosols are tiny particles suspended in the atmosphere, both solid and liquid, with sources ranging from volcanic eruptions to dust storms. These particles play a key role in climate and air quality, affecting everything from weather patterns to ecosystem health. Understanding this concept can enhance your knowledge of ecology.

The Role of Aerosols in Our Atmosphere

Now, let’s dig a little deeper. Aerosols are more than just fleeting particles in the air; they play a crucial role in the Earth’s energy balance. Here’s the thing: when sunlight hits these particles, they either scatter or absorb the light. What happens next is like a cosmic game of “hot potato”; depending on the type and quantity of aerosols in the air, sunlight can either be reflected back into space or trapped within the atmosphere, affecting temperatures below. It’s a complicated dance that keeps our climate in check—and any disruptions could lead to bigger problems.

The Bigger Picture: Climate Change and Aerosols

You know what? There’s an ongoing discussion about aerosols' role in climate change, too. Some studies suggest that aerosol pollution could actually mask global warming by reflecting sunlight. It's puzzling, because while they might offer temporary relief from rising temperatures, they also contribute to long-term problems, including respiratory issues in humans and changes in ecological balances.
